Carolina Barco Isakson ( born 1951 ) is a Colombian-American diplomat, who has served as Ambassador of Colombia to the United States from 2006 to 2010, and Minister of Foreign Affairs of Colombia from 2002 to 2007.

Carolina Barco Isakson is the daughter of Virgilio Barco Vargas, a former Mayor, Senator, Ambassador, President of Colombia and Director to the World Bank Board, and Carolina Isakson Proctor.
Carolina's brother, Virgilio Barco Isakson, founded one of Colombia's largest gay civil rights NGO's in Colombia called Colombia Diversa.
Barco returned to Colombia in 1954 to help negotiate the peace process which allowed the formation of the National Front between liberals and conservatives, which lasted two decades.
